    Understanding the Landscape of Mental Health in Indonesia

    Okay, so let's get real. Mental health awareness in Indonesia has come a long way, but there's still a massive gap. Stigma is a huge issue, with many people feeling ashamed or afraid to seek help. This can be down to various factors, including traditional beliefs, limited access to mental health professionals, and a lack of open conversations about mental health in communities. Understanding these challenges is the first step to finding solutions. The cultural context plays a big role. What might be considered 'normal' stress in one society could be a sign of a deeper issue in another. It's super important to recognize these differences and to tailor mental health services to be culturally sensitive. This means understanding local customs, beliefs, and values. It also means building trust within communities, because let's face it, if people don't trust the system, they won't use it.

    Access to mental healthcare is another hurdle. In many parts of Indonesia, there's a serious shortage of psychiatrists, psychologists, and counselors. This means long wait times, limited options, and increased difficulties in getting the help you need. This is especially true outside of major cities. People in rural areas often face even greater challenges, including geographic barriers, financial constraints, and a lack of awareness about available resources. The government, along with NGOs and private organizations, is working to improve access, but there's still a lot of work to be done.
